The Lapford Revel!


 

 

Program of Events:

Monday 5th July
The Revel 2010 Race Night @ Old Malt Scoop first race at 8.30PM

Tuesday 6th July
Lapford & District Horticultural Society Rose & Sweet pea Show @ Lapford Victory Hall. Open from 8-00pm. Admission 50p

Wednesday 7th July
Lapford Football Club Grand Charity Bingo. Many Prizes available. Lapford Victory Hall. Doors open 7:00pm, Eyes Down 8.00pm

Thursday 8th July - On The Village Green
6.45pm
: The Royal Procession, will start at the Village Car Park. The Church bells will ring out to announce the beginning of the procession.
7.30pm: The Crowning Ceremony commences on the Village Green.
7.45pm: Dancing display by children from Lapford CP School and street dancing by Caution

Friday 9th July
5.00pm
: The Revel Tea at Lapford CP School with entertainment from Uncle Bobby at the School. Open to all children up to the age of 11, from Lapford and Nymet Roland
6.45pm: The Revel Fun and Games Evening organised by the Yeo Valley Fellowship on the Playing Field. Entry is free and there are prizes for the top teams. Teams will consist of 4 people, two of whom must be under 14s. Enter your team on the night with Richard Yendell. There will be a limit of 12 teams.

Saturday 10th July
10.00 – 12.00  - Judging of Scarecrow competition by Mary Brown

1.30 pm  – Fayre to be opened by Sue Briant-Evans with The Revel King & Queen

1.45 pm – Uncle Bobby

2.30 pm – Punch & Judy Show

3.15 pm – Uncle Bobby

4.00 pm – Punch & Judy Show

4.30 pm – Tug of War and Welly throwing competitions

5.30 pm – Draw and prize giving

6.00 pm – 11.00pm Music from local artists down on the Playing Field with the BBQ and chips available until 10.00pm

Sunday 11th July

6.00pm The Revel Victorian Songs of Praise in the St.Thomas of Canterbury Church will involve the Revel King and Queen along with other members of the community in a celebration of the Revel and our village.

It’s all Old Hat – Bring along your “Victorian style hat” for judging by the Revel King & Queen.
